Vulnerability in OpenSSL - Using a Custom Cipher with NID_undef may lead to NULL encryption
OpenSSL supports creating a custom cipher via the legacy EVPCIPHERmethnew function and associated function calls. This function was deprecated in OpenSSL 3.0 and application authors are instead encouraged to use the new provider mechanism in order to implement custom ciphers. OpenSSL versions 3.0...
